Sasha "Pink" Jansen has heard the voice of God. He spoke loud and clear at her purity ceremony, when she was just sixteen years old and Pastor Malik Stroman placed that ring on her finger. And He was just as clear when He told her that purity ring would someday be replaced with a wedding ring from the same man ... all Pink had to do was save herself. Dreams of a life with Pastor Malik were enough to keep the privileged princess committed to her vow, dodging all kinds of temptation, resisting every romance, and the whole time, keeping her eyes on the prize--the day she would become first lady. There's just one problem--Pastor Malik already has a wife. But Pink is accustomed to getting what she wants--by any means necessary. With her grace and virtue on the line--and what she thinks is God's word in her head--Pink is on a mission no one understands. She's determined to show Pastor Malik that they belong together--and come hell or high water, she plans to get the good reverend to agree. Candy Jackson has penned a page-turning tale of one-woman's quest for love and the spiraling descent she'll take to get it" --Page 4 of cover.
